Harper's Bazaar Czech Republic delivers a masterclass in high-fashion editorial storytelling with its September issue, blending sharp aesthetic precision with a refined, contemporary sensibility. Through the lens of photographer Abdullah Artuev, the feature captures a sophisticated dialogue between structural minimalism and opulent maximalism, anchored by the compelling presence of model Hana Jirickova. The imagery leans into a sleek, editorial minimalism that elevates the publication's brand identity, while fashion director Jan Králíček expertly curates an aesthetic landscape where intricate, heavily embellished gowns collide with the stark, graphic intensity of high-collared silhouettes. The visual narrative relies heavily on balanced, even lighting—specifically utilizing beauty light and soft light techniques—to emphasize the tactile quality of sequined textures and bold, avant-garde makeup applications like vibrant blue eyeshadow. Each frame feels calculated yet intimate, moving from the quiet intensity of a neutral studio portrait to the rigid symmetry of a crisp, white-backdrop composition. This commercial project effectively navigates the intersection of classic print prestige and modern editorial design, utilizing distinct typographic overlays in gold and black to solidify a cohesive, high-end look. By favoring intentional composition and sharp, clean lines over excessive staging, the team creates a timeless editorial spread that resonates with both industry insiders and the broader luxury fashion market.
